Transaction 0b208e50f767c0ff55ceaa682f3186af31f19f7c5a973abe5f8f116006f8f505

block
25834374bff4e38a84e2baccfab8ab647baa9ba62cbdb35b7ef1b32ba4fa6e50

56 Inputs

2 Outputs